Detailed Project Description

Because of the increasing carbon dioxide and its danger to our planet, and after examining and pointing on its causes, the second most common reason was factories, according to what was mentioned in the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), we came up with our idea:

 Putting a detention room for the carbon dioxide in the middle of the factory chimneys and converting it into oxygen, and also working to absorb the carbon dioxide circulating in the air around these factories and converting it into oxygen. about these factories. And this room is linked to the data of the GES DISC NASA so that it sends notifications to the control center of this room of the presence of carbon dioxide scattered around these factories.

 

In the future, we will work on 

setting rooms similar to this system that absorb carbon dioxide from within countries saturated with carbon dioxide resulting from cars and other fuels, as well as abandons countries that use wood and other solid fuels, such as using raw coal for cooking and heating.
